El Mirador, Palm Springs,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in El Mirador?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| El Mirador 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,650 | $1,650 | $1,650 |
How much does it cost to rent a home in El Mirador?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$1,995 | $1,995 | $1,995 |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$6,765 | $2,295 | $9,000 |
| 5 Bedroom Homes | $30,000 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|
